Returns after a strong freshman season . . . will make the move from second base to shortstop . . . a very talented infielder who is expected to be one of the leaders of this year's team.

2008 (Freshman): Saw action in 56 games, including 52 starts at second base . . . finished third on the team with a .325 batting average . . . had 10 doubles and 27 RBI . . . had 20 multiple-hit games, the second most on the team . . . had eight multiple-RBI games . . . went 2-for-5 in the third game of the Kennesaw State series . . . was a combined 6-for-12 with two RBI and a triple in three games against St. Louis . . . went 2-for-4 with an RBI in game three against Miami of Ohio . . . went 2-for-3 at Alabama . . . went 2-for-4 with a double and two RBI in final game of Tennessee-Martin series . . . went 2-for-3 with an RBI in game two at Murray State . . . went 3-for-5 with a double against Georgia State . . . was 2-for-4 with two RBI in game two of Austin Peay series . . . was 2-for-4 with a double against Mercer . . . went 3-for-6 in game one at Southeast Missouri . . . went 2-for-5 with two RBI at Auburn . . . went 3-for-6 in game three of Eastern Illinois series . . . went 2-for-3 in home game against Alabama . . . went 2-for-5 with an RBI in final game at Eastern Kentucky . . . had five hits and drove in five runs in three games against Morehead State . . . was 4-for-7 with two RBI in games one and two at Tennessee Tech . . . went 2-for-5 against Tennessee Tech in the OVC Tournament.

High School: Three-year varsity letterman at Gulf Coast High School . . . named his team's Defensive Player of theYear as a freshman Offensive Player of theYear as a junior . . . named All-Conference, All-Area and All-Southwest Florida in 2006 and 2007 . . . helped his team to a 23-0 record as a junior.
